High Court Upholds Russ Second Degree Murder Conviction

The Nebraska Supreme Court affirmed William Muss Russ’s second degree murder conviction in the 1971 Omaha shooting of Benny Thanas. The ruling, written by Judge Leslie High, rejected self defense claims and noted repeated threats and violent conduct by Russ. The court also upheld related lower court decisions on several other cases.

City council backs plans for 1976 Bicentennial Fountain in Omaha

Funds are set for a Missouri River Bicentennial Friendship Fountain to be built on the lava shore near Douglas Street in Omaha with partial pledges totaling 18 000 and a $200 000 goal. Council Bluffs and Omaha provide matching money as planners envision three 75 foot water jets and a twin tower design ready for the July 4 1976 celebrations.

Nebraskan tax fight roils legislature over Exon budget

A week of dramatic moves in the Nebraska Legislature centered on Gov. Exon's budget and proposed tax cuts. Senators sparred over a 15 to 10 percent income tax reduction and a sales tax drop, with several lawmakers urging restraint and a plan to pass only LB259 and related salary bills before adjourning. The feud exposed party fault lines and raised questions about leadership and political timing ahead of the governor's election year.

Drivers injured in two-truck accident near Clarkson spur

At the Clarkson spur and Highway 91 intersection in Colfax County two trucks collided. Edwin Kabes of Clarkson drove a 1905 pickup. Donald Herout of Fremont piloted an 18,400 pound milk tank truck. Both drivers were seriously injured and taken to Memorial Hospital by Clarkson rescue. Work crews pumped milk from the overturned truck.

Bellevue group seeks permit for four child hostel

The Nebraska Association for Retarded Children, based in Bellevue, again seeks a special use permit to operate a four child hostel in a house. The plan aims to provide housing for children with disabilities under a city approval process, with neighbors awaiting a decision.
